Relevant NTEH Development definition

Relevant NTEH Development means a specified NT development as defined in section 5 of the Residential Properties (First-hand Sales) Ordinance (Cap. 621) where, under the Government Grant, the consent of the Director of Lands is not required to be given for this sale and purchase;] (u) “Statutory Declaration” means the Statutory Declaration of the Vendor’s Solicitors and all other solicitors (if any) acting for the Vendor registered in the Land Registry by Memorial No. [insert memorial number] in relation to the consent of the Director of Lands to sell the Property; and (v) “Vendor’s Solicitors” means Messrs. [insert name of solicitors’ firm of the vendor]. (2) [In this Agreement - (a) “saleable area” has the meaning given by section 8 of the Residential Properties (First-hand Sales) Ordinance (Cap. 621); (b) the floor area of an item under paragraph (a) of Schedule 4 is calculated in accordance with section 8(3) of that Ordinance; and (c) the area of an item under paragraph (b) of Schedule 4 is calculated in accordance with Part 2 of Schedule 2 to that Ordinance.] OR [In this Agreement, the area of the Property is measured from the centre of its demarcating lines or (if applicable) the interior face of the enclosing walls.] (3) In this Agreement, if the context permits or requires, the singular number includes the plural and the masculine gender includes the feminine and the neuter.
